On Thu, Apr 05, 2001 at 10:10:47PM +0100, Michael G Schwern wrote: > I think he's saying that its annoying to have to write any sort of tag > that says "Hey, I'm starting a new Perl 6 program here!" at the top of > every single program, much in the same way its tiresome to write "int > main(...)" in every C program. Then again, we already have to do the > #! thing. So have "#!/usr/bin/perl6" do an implicit "module main" in the absence of any other module declaration. -- Putting heated bricks close to the news.admin.net-abuse.* groups. -- Megahal (trained on asr), 1998-11-06
